服务器防御DDoS(分布式拒绝服务)攻击的方法有多种,以下是一些常见的防御方法:
(速盾网络)(www.sudun.com)全新上线,时时24小时客服和技术团队,为你的网站或游戏app,保驾护航,让你的网络无后顾之忧。
1.流量清洗和过滤:
2.使用专业的DDoS防护设备或服务,进行流量清洗和过滤。这些设备能够检测和过滤掉恶意流量,只将合法的流量传递到服务器。
3.负载均衡和水平扩展:
4.配置负载均衡设备,将流量分散到多个服务器上。这可以分担单个服务器的压力,并增加系统的处理能力。
5.黑白名单过滤:
6.根据IP地址、用户代理等信息,设置黑白名单过滤规则,阻止恶意IP或User-Agent访问服务器。
7.连接速率限制:
8.设置连接速率限制,限制每个IP地址能够同时建立的连接数。这可以防止攻击者通过大量的连接占用服务器资源。
9.IP封堵和阻断:
10.在检测到DDoS攻击时,及时封堵或阻断攻击源的IP地址,以减轻攻击对服务器的影响。
11.缓存和CDN加速:
12.配置缓存和CDN(内容分发网络),将静态内容缓存到CDN节点,减轻对服务器的请求压力,并提高响应速度。
13.反向代理和负载调整:
14.使用反向代理服务器和负载调整工具,将请求分发到多个后端服务器上。这样可以均衡负载,减少攻击对单个服务器的影响。
15.网络流量分析和行为检测:
16.使用网络流量分析工具和行为检测系统,以识别异常的流量模式和攻击行为。这有助于快速发现和应对DDoS攻击。
17.云托管和自动缩放:
18.将服务器托管在云环境中,利用云服务商的自动缩放功能,根据流量需求动态调整服务器资源。
19.事前计划和灾备准备:
20.制定事前的DDoS防御计划,并建立灾备准备措施,以应对潜在的攻击。这可以包括DDoS演练、备份系统和数据、紧急响应计划等。
综合使用这些方法可以加强服务器的DDoS防护能力,并最大程度地减轻DDoS攻击对服务器的影响。值得一提的是,DDoS攻击技术不断演进,防御方法也需要不断更新和优化,以适应新的威胁。